Lauren Scott, PT,MPT, ATC received her BS from Boise State University in Athletic Training and her master's degree in Physical Therapy from the University of Utah. Lauren's interests include treatment of the spine, hip and pelvis, women's & men's health, prenatal/postpartum pelvic pain/dysfunction, and incontinence (urinary & fecal).  She has received advanced training from the Herman and Wallace Pelvic Rehab Institute.  Lauren is currently pursuing advanced certifications in manual therapy from NAIOMT and biofeedback from BCIA in pelvic muscle dysfunction. She is also certified on the full line of Pilates apparatus from Polestar Education and CORE Align from Balanced Body University.

In 2004, Lauren set out to create a new type of practice, which would take a holistic approach to the overall well-being of her patients.  This allows patients to take a more active role in their health, incorporating Pilates with physical therapy.
